    JUST IN: DOJ Drops Charges Against 3 More Reflecting Pool Vandalism Defendants – Pirro Meets With Trump at White House Following Scathing Rebuke (VIDEO)

    It’s now been revealed, after Trump blasted US Attorney Jeanine Pirro for dropping charges against former Olympian David Hearn, that the Department of Justice moved to drop charges against three more defendants accused of vandalizing the Lincoln Memorial Reflecting Pool. 

    On Monday, Trump slammed Jeanine Pirro during an Oval Office press conference, saying she “choked.” Trump added, “I was disappointed with Jeanine Pirro, really disappointed with Jeanine Pirro. She folded like an umbrella, and people get away with things, and it’s a disgrace.”

    Following the press conference, Pirro was spotted at the White House, where she met with the President. CNN’s Kaitlan Collins reported that Pirro and Interior Secretary Doug Burgum were seen separately entering the West Wing to attend the same meeting with the President. Sources told CNN that Pirro was not fired and did not offer a resignation.

    Now, we’re finding out that Pirro also moved to dismiss charges against Justin Carreno, Sophie Dennison-Gibby, and Cameron Thiers, all of whom were accused of vandalizing the Reflecting Pool. According to court documents, Pirro’s office moved to dismiss all three cases last Friday, the same day they moved to dismiss charges against Hearn.

    Over a dozen people have been arrested or cited for their suspected roles in the vandalism, Jeanine Pirro claimed in June, but the most notable arrest was that of David Hearn.

    A grand jury in far-left DC returned an indictment of the three-time Olympic canoeist for his alleged vandalism of the reflecting pool last month. Hearn faced up to ten years in prison after a grand jury in the DC Superior Court returned the indictment.

    When he was arrested in June, local independent journalist Emily Miller appeared to catch his arrest on camera. She shared the clip on X, saying he was vandalizing the pool and tried to impede workers cleaning the pool by “grabb[ing] the hose that female National Park Service workers were using to clear the algae.” It is unclear if this claim was even presented to the grand jury that returned an indictment. Miller further said in June that a man was arrested after jumping into the pool today and cutting out a “huge piece” of the sealant.

    However, as The Gateway Pundit reported, the Justice Department dropped the charges against Hearn on Friday. US Attorney Jeanine Pirro, who previously accused Hearn of “violently and forcefully” ripping up the sealant, claimed on Friday that “flawed installation by the contractor” was responsible for the damage.

    “It was not until after the return of the indictment [of Hearn], that the [Department of Interior] provided additional documents to the [US Attorney’s Office in DC] indicating that damage to the Lincoln Memorial Reflecting Pool in June 2026 was the result of flawed installation by the contractor, Atlantic Industrial Coatings, and the rush to complete the project prior to events associated with the America 250 celebration in the weeks surrounding Independence Day 2026,” Pirro’s office wrote in the filing.

    Trump lashed out at Pirro on Saturday morning, slamming her for dismissing the case. Likewise, Interior Secretary Doug Burgum also blasted Pirro’s office, pushing back on its claim that his department misled prosecutors. “The evidence is clear, vandals have repeatedly caused damage to the Reflecting Pool. Some of these acts were even caught on camera. We also provided the U.S. Attorney’s office expert and eyewitness testimony to the damage done by vandals and provided every piece of evidence they asked for in the requested time line detailing each area of damage at the pool,” Burgum wrote.

    Trump further shared a four-minute-long surveillance video of alleged vandals after Pirro dropped the charges, writing on Truth Social, “Look for yourselves at the VANDALISM that took place at The Reflecting Pool. The material is being cut with a knife or a box cutter, for all to see!” Previously, the US Park Police shared part of this footage and requested help from the public in identifying the suspect as part of a destruction of government property investigation.
